2. Transferring Marriott Points to Airline Partners

One of the most common ways to use Marriott points for air travel is by transferring them to partner airlines.

2.1. How Airline Transfers Work

Marriott Bonvoy allows members to transfer points to over 39 airline programs, offering a flexible way to redeem points for flights.

  • Transfer Ratio: The standard transfer ratio is typically 3:1, meaning 3 Marriott Bonvoy points convert to 1 airline mile. For example, 3,000 Marriott points would yield 1,000 airline miles.
  • Bonus Miles: Marriott often provides bonus miles for transferring points in larger quantities. For instance, you might receive 5,000 bonus miles for every 60,000 points transferred.
  • Transfer Time: Transfer times can vary widely, so it’s essential to plan ahead, especially if you need the miles for a specific flight.
  • According to The Points Guy, transfer times can vary widely, so consider placing an award ticket hold if you’re afraid that the seats will disappear before the transfer is processed.

2.2. Airlines with a 3:1 Transfer Ratio

Most airline partners offer a 3:1 transfer ratio, but it’s essential to confirm the current rate on the Marriott Bonvoy website.

Airline Transfer Ratio Bonus
Alaska Airlines 3:1 Yes (5,000)
American Airlines 3:1 No
British Airways 3:1 Yes (5,000)
Delta Air Lines 3:1 No
Emirates 3:1 Yes (5,000)
Flying Blue (Air France/KLM) 3:1 Yes (5,000)
Japan Airlines 3:1 Yes (5,000)
United Airlines 3:1 Yes (10,000)

Note: Bonus miles are typically awarded for every 60,000 points transferred.

2.3. Enhanced Partnerships with United Airlines

Marriott Bonvoy’s partnership with United Airlines is particularly rewarding.

  • Bonus Miles: United Airlines provides 10,000 bonus miles for every 60,000 points transferred, enhancing the value of your points.
  • Transfer Benefits: This partnership can be beneficial for those looking to accumulate United MileagePlus miles for specific flight rewards.

2.4. Considerations for Airline Transfers

Before transferring your Marriott points to an airline, consider these factors:

  • Evaluate Redemption Value: Determine the value you’ll get from the airline miles compared to other redemption options, such as hotel stays.
  • Check Award Availability: Confirm that the desired flights are available for award booking before transferring your points.
  • Compare Transfer Bonuses: Keep an eye out for limited-time transfer bonuses that can significantly increase the value of your points.

3. Booking Flights Directly Through Marriott

Marriott Bonvoy allows you to book flights directly through its website. While convenient, this method may not always offer the best value.

3.1. How to Book Flights

To book flights using Marriott points, follow these steps:

  1. Visit Marriott Bonvoy Website: Log in to your Marriott Bonvoy account and navigate to the “Use Points” section.
  2. Select Flights: Choose the option to book flights.
  3. Enter Flight Details: Enter your departure and arrival cities, travel dates, and number of passengers.
  4. Review Options: Browse the available flight options and compare prices in points and cash.
  5. Book Your Flight: Select your preferred flight and complete the booking process using your Marriott Bonvoy points.

3.2. Value of Points for Flights

The value you get per Marriott point when booking flights directly is typically lower than when redeeming for hotel stays or transferring to airline partners.

  • Average Redemption Value: On average, you might get around 0.4 to 0.6 cents per point when booking flights through Marriott.
  • Example: A flight that costs $200 might require 40,000 to 50,000 Marriott points.

3.3. When to Consider Booking Flights Directly

While not always the best value, booking flights directly through Marriott might be worth considering in certain situations:

  • Lack of Award Availability: If you can’t find award availability with airline partners, booking directly might be your only option.
  • Convenience: If you prefer the convenience of booking flights and hotels in one place, this option can be appealing.
  • Small Points Balance: If you have a small number of Marriott points that aren’t enough for a hotel stay or airline transfer, booking a flight directly can be a way to use them.

4. Maximizing Value: Hotel Stays vs. Airline Transfers

When deciding how to use your Marriott points, it’s crucial to compare the value of hotel stays versus airline transfers.

4.1. Hotel Stays

Redeeming Marriott points for hotel stays often provides the best value, especially at luxury properties or during peak travel times.

  • Average Redemption Value: You can often get 0.8 to 1.2 cents per point when redeeming for hotel stays.
  • Fifth Night Free: Marriott offers a “fifth night free” benefit when booking five consecutive nights on points, further enhancing the value.
  • Cash + Points: Using the Cash + Points option can also provide good value by reducing the number of points required for a stay.

4.2. Airline Transfers: A Strategic Approach

While airline transfers may not always offer the highest value, they can be strategic in certain scenarios:

  • Top Up Miles Balance: If you need a few more miles to reach a specific award flight, transferring Marriott points can be a quick solution.
  • Leverage Obscure Miles: Transferring to airlines with less common miles currencies can open up unique award flight opportunities.
  • Limited-Time Bonuses: Keep an eye out for transfer bonuses that can significantly increase the value of your points.

5. Step-by-Step Guide: Transferring Marriott Points to Airlines

If you decide that transferring Marriott points to an airline is the best option for you, here’s a step-by-step guide:

  1. Log into Your Account: Go to the Marriott Bonvoy website and log in to your account.
  2. Navigate to Transfer Points: Find the “Transfer Points” or “Redeem Points” section and select the option to transfer to airline partners.
  3. Choose Airline Partner: Select the airline you want to transfer your points to from the list of partners.
  4. Enter Transfer Details: Enter your frequent flyer number and the number of Marriott points you want to transfer.
  5. Review and Confirm: Review the transfer details and confirm the transaction.
  6. Wait for Transfer: Wait for the points to be transferred to your airline account. Transfer times can vary, so check the estimated timeframe on the Marriott website.

5.1. Tips for a Smooth Transfer

  • Ensure Matching Names: Make sure the name on your Marriott Bonvoy account matches the name on your frequent flyer account.
  • Check Minimum Transfer Requirements: Be aware of any minimum transfer requirements.
  • Plan Ahead: Transfer points well in advance of when you need them to avoid any delays.

7. Best Marriott Bonvoy Credit Cards

Earning Marriott Bonvoy points is easier with a co-branded credit card. Here are some of the best options:

7.1. Marriott Bonvoy Brilliant® American Express® Card

  • Welcome Bonus: Earn 185,000 Marriott Bonvoy bonus points after spending $6,000 in purchases within the first six months of card membership.
  • Earning Rates: 6 points per dollar spent on eligible purchases at hotels participating in the Marriott Bonvoy program; 3 points per dollar at restaurants worldwide and on flights booked directly with airlines; 2 points per dollar on other purchases.
  • Benefits: Automatic Marriott Platinum Elite status, free night award worth up to 85,000 points each year, up to $300 in statement credits for restaurant purchases, Priority Pass Select membership, and reimbursement for Global Entry or TSA PreCheck fees.
  • Annual Fee: $650.

7.2. Marriott Bonvoy Business® American Express® Card

  • Welcome Bonus: Earn three Free Night Awards after you use your new Card to make $6,000 in eligible purchases within the first six months of Card Membership. Each Free Night Award has a redemption level up to 50,000 Marriott Bonvoy® points, for a total potential value of up to 150,000 points, at hotels participating in Marriott Bonvoy®.
  • Earning Rates: 6 points per dollar on eligible purchases at hotels participating in the Marriott Bonvoy program; 4 points per dollar spent at restaurants worldwide and U.S. gas stations, on wireless telephone services purchased directly from U.S. service providers, and on purchases made from merchants in the U.S. for shipping; 2 Marriott Bonvoy Business® American Express® Card points per dollar on all other eligible purchases.
  • Benefits: Automatic Marriott Gold Elite status and an annual free night award worth up to 35,000 points.
  • Annual Fee: $125.

7.3. Marriott Bonvoy Boundless® Credit Card

  • New Cardmember Bonus: Earn three free night awards after spending $3,000 on purchases in the first three months from account opening. Each night is valued up to 50,000 points.
  • Earning Rates: 6 points per dollar on eligible Marriott Bonvoy purchases; 3 points per dollar on the first $6,000 spent in combined purchases yearly on grocery stores, gas stations, and dining; 2 points per dollar on all other eligible purchases.
  • Benefits: An annual free night certificate (up to 35,000 points) for each cardmember anniversary; 15 elite night credits annually; one additional credit toward elite status for every $5,000 you spend.
  • Annual Fee: $95.

7.4. Marriott Bonvoy Bold® Credit Card

  • New Cardmember Bonus: Earn 30,000 bonus points after spending $1,000 on purchases in the first three months from account opening.
  • Earning Rates: 3 points per dollar on eligible purchases at hotels participating in the Marriott Bonvoy program; 2 points per dollar at grocery stores, rideshare, select food delivery, select streaming, internet, cable, and phone services; 1 point per dollar on other purchases.
  • Benefits: Complimentary Silver Elite status and 5 elite night credits yearly.
  • Annual Fee: $0.

7.5. Marriott Bonvoy Bevy™ American Express® Card

  • Welcome Bonus: Earn 155,000 Marriott Bonvoy bonus points after spending $5,000 in purchases within the first six months of card membership.
  • Earning Rates: 6 points per dollar on purchases at hotels participating in the Marriott Bonvoy program; 4 points per dollar on the first $15,000 per year in combined purchases at restaurants worldwide and U.S. supermarkets (then 2 points per dollar); 2 points per dollar on other eligible purchases.
  • Benefits: Complimentary, automatic Marriott Gold status, a free night award worth up to 50,000 points for cardholders who make at least $15,000 in eligible purchases during their cardmember year.
  • Annual Fee: $250.

10. FAQs About Using Marriott Points for Air Travel

10.1. Can I transfer Marriott points to any airline?

No, Marriott Bonvoy partners with specific airlines, allowing you to transfer points to their frequent flyer programs. Check the Marriott Bonvoy website for a list of current airline partners.

10.2. What is the typical transfer ratio for Marriott points to airline miles?

The typical transfer ratio is 3:1, meaning 3 Marriott Bonvoy points convert to 1 airline mile. However, some airlines may offer different ratios or bonus miles for transferring larger quantities.

10.3. How long does it take for Marriott points to transfer to airline miles?

Transfer times can vary, but it generally takes a few days to a week for the miles to appear in your airline account. Check the Marriott Bonvoy website for estimated transfer times for each airline partner.

10.4. Is it better to use Marriott points for hotel stays or airline transfers?

In most cases, redeeming Marriott points for hotel stays offers better value. However, airline transfers can be strategic if you need to top up your miles balance or leverage obscure miles currencies.

10.5. Can I book flights directly through Marriott Bonvoy?

Yes, Marriott Bonvoy allows you to book flights directly through its website. However, this option may not always provide the best value compared to other redemption options.

10.6. What is the value of a Marriott point when booking flights directly?

The value of a Marriott point when booking flights directly is typically lower than when redeeming for hotel stays or transferring to airline partners, often around 0.4 to 0.6 cents per point.
